Pulled the inside cover / air distribution panel plus a small plastic access panel inside that. Note there are six (6) screws holding on the cover. The coach to Dometic wiring can be accessed from inside and it uses plug connecting the two and not a terminal block (pictures forthcoming). No visible issues. No crispy or charred wire insulation. Nothing out of the ordinary.
We decided to get a mobile mechanical out to pull the cover on the roof. You can't see any of the Dometic side of the wiring from inside. Whatever is found, we'll pull the cover on the 2nd unit to check it as well even though that unit was running fine with no issues.
If you do an internet search, you do see a few posts from different RVs (coach and trailer type) where smoke develops on rooftop AC units due to a loose connection causing some resistance at a connection where there would normally be none. That or an overheated motor are the only things I could think of that would cause the issue. The coach side wiring was fine. The unit was cooling at the time it was shut down.

Inspect the radiused edges of the fiberglass roof, where it goes underneath the front cap. The gaps are about .25” at the ends of the seam, so check there first for voids in the caulking.
If you have the Dometic a/c’s, the exterior shroud is fastened on by 4 torx screws. That’s simple to remove if you just want to check for any visible signs of damage.
-
Second Cal's comment about the exterior Dometic covers. I replaced both of mine after some hail damage last year. One screw at each corner, they lift right off, and you have good visibility of the unit. Even on the road, if you have the rear ladder (or other ready access to the top of your rig), it's about a 15-minute job to inspect.

I noticed a water stain on my PC inside wall when I bought it (10 y.o. at the time). It was impossible to tell how old the mark was, but I tracked it to the wires for the awning. So,,, I sealed it up inside and out with butyl & dicor. I made sure that the wires on the outside led down and away from the hole so that water didn't run down them TO the hole. I've never seen any indicators of it leaking since.
I also got the water stain off with some diluted oxiclean.

The Dometic compressor motor and fan (inside air blower) are two different motors.
Just listen to it when you first turn it on. The fan will run blowing the air and the 30 seconds or so and you can hear the compressor turn on. As the a/c runs, you can hear the fan speed go up or down and the compressor turn on and off.
I installed a Soft Start on my a/c. The compressor motor is inside a sealed unit that is above the roof.
This was on a Dometic Penguin II.

Significant Update - water leak appears to be fixed. We've gone through a rain event and no leak. One of the spots where sealant was applied was the wiring for the awning entering the coach.
Bigger update. We found the source of the smoke and it wasn't the HVAC units despite smelling it at each. On our last outing, we ended up having an issue of smoke when not just the front unit running but the rear as well. We shut both down and ran on the roof fans planning on just driving home despite being there not even a day. Sometime later that evening we realized that we were running on battery power. Despite cycling the shore breaker and even changing to 30 amp, no power was coming in.
Fast forward a couple of weeks. Accessed the EMS, tested, and even talked with Progressive Industries with an end conclusion that the EMS was operating correctly. The next focus was the ATS. Sure enough the negative lead was the problem. The wire got hot enough that it melted the whole shore terminal block, insulation on both hot leads, and melted an aluminum bus / terminal bar on the shore. The HVAC units were just circulating the smoke and were never the source. I'm thinking a loose connection on the negative lead.
We have a replacement ATS on its way. Fair warning for those with the 50 amp Intellitec ATS, they are not currently producing them as they are being redesigned. Most places are out of stock.
Moral of the story - make a plan to check your wiring terminations that use mechanical connections. I'm planning on checking the EMS, ATS, main distribution panel, inverter/converter and genset connections annually.
